Syrian government says it has struck ceasefire deal with Kurdish-led forces

Damascus has announced a ceasefire agreement with the Kurdish-led Syrian Democratic Forces (SDF) amidst ongoing military actions in northeastern Syria. The terms of the deal include the integration of SDF forces into the Syrian government's defense and interior ministries. This development comes as Syrian troops intensify their operations in Kurdish-held regions.

The Syrian conflict has been characterized by shifting alliances and ongoing violence since its inception in 2011. The Kurdish-led SDF has been a key player in the fight against ISIS, but their relationship with the Syrian government has been fraught with tension. This ceasefire could represent a pragmatic approach by the Syrian government to stabilize its control over the northeast amid ongoing challenges.
